UPDATE: Florida Fire Closes Portion of I-95

A state of emergency was declared Monday in Florida by Gov. Charlie Crist as wildfires burned towards homes and businesses and forced the closure of a portion of Interstate 95 in Brevard County.

A number of homes have reportedly been destroyed by the biggest fires burning in the county, aided by windy conditions. Three firefighters have reportedly been injured.

Gov. Crist put the National Guard into action to help fight the blazes and assist with evacuating residents. A number of schools in the Palm Bay area will be closed on Tuesday.

One of the fires is reportedly being considered arson and a $10,000 reward has been offered for information leading to the arrest and conviction of anyone involved.
